How to identify
The pea aphid is a prominent member of the Aphididae family, known for its distinct pale green to yellowish-green coloration which provides excellent camouflage on leguminous plants.
Adults typically measure between 4 to 5 mm in length and possess long, slender legs, allowing them to navigate quickly across the stems and leaves of host plants.
They are characterized by exceptionally long antennae and prominent siphunculi at the rear end, which are key identification features under a magnifying glass.
The species exhibits polymorphism, with both wingless and winged individuals; winged morphs are produced when the population density reaches a threshold, facilitating migration to new fields.
Reproduction follows a complex cycle, involving overwintering eggs on perennial legumes, followed by a rapid series of asexual generations during the growing season.
What it damages
Pea aphids primarily target legumes such as peas, lentils, and alfalfa, but they are also known to infest onions, beets, oilseed rape, cabbage, hemp, peppers, melons, and sunflowers.
The primary damage results from phloem sap extraction, which directly removes essential nutrients and moisture, weakening the host plant significantly.
Feeding often causes physiological stress, leading to stunted growth, leaf curling, and yellowing of the infested parts, particularly the succulent apical shoots.
Perhaps the most severe economic impact is the damage to flowers and young pods, which can lead to complete floral abortion or the development of thin, deformed seeds.
Furthermore, these aphids act as vectors for various plant viruses, such as pea enation mosaic virus, which can cause devastating outbreaks across entire agricultural regions.
When it appears
Emergence occurs in early spring when overwintered eggs hatch as temperatures consistently stay above 10°C, initiating the first colonizing generations on perennial host plants.
As the season progresses into summer, the life cycle shortens to approximately one week, enabling rapid population spikes that can quickly engulf entire fields.
The critical peak period for damage occurs during the flowering and pod-filling stages of legumes, when the plant's nutrient transport is most vulnerable.
In mid-summer, high temperatures can sometimes limit reproduction, though the presence of lush, irrigated crops can sustain high populations late into the season.
As days shorten in autumn, sexual forms develop and produce eggs, which are then deposited on the stems of perennial legumes to ensure survival through the winter.
Signs of infestation
Early symptoms include localized yellowing and crinkling of leaves, as aphids congregate in high densities on the youngest, most nutritious parts of the plant.
The accumulation of honeydew on the lower foliage, often accompanied by the growth of sooty mold, is a classic indication of an established aphid colony.
Large, visible colonies of green insects can be found clustered on stems, flowers, and the undersides of leaves, often accompanied by ants.
Ant activity on the plants is a strong indicator of aphid presence, as the ants tend the aphids to feed on their sugary excrement, protecting them from predators.
Deformed or withered blossoms and undersized, distorted pods are clear signs that the plant's development has been compromised by prolonged feeding.
Control measures
Cultural strategies are fundamental, including the physical separation of new pea fields from perennial clover or alfalfa stands that host overwintering populations.
Maintaining a weed-free field environment is essential, as many common weeds can serve as bridge hosts for the pea aphid during the early season.
Effective management requires scouting programs to ensure that insecticide applications occur only when the economic threshold is reached, protecting beneficial insects.
Biological control agents, including lady beetles, lacewings, and parasitic wasps, play a vital role in suppressing populations and should be encouraged via reduced pesticide use.
In cases of heavy infestation, systemic insecticides are the preferred tool, providing long-lasting protection against reinvasion during the critical stages of crop growth.

Taxonomy
- Latin name
- Acyrthosiphon pisum
- Order
- Hemiptera (bugs, aphids, leafhoppers)
- Family
- Aphididae
- EPPO code
- ACYRON
